Introduction

Night cream is an essential part of any skincare routine, especially for those looking to maintain hydrated and youthful skin. Unlike regular moisturizers, night creams are formulated with richer ingredients that work synergistically to repair and replenish the skin overnight. These creams often contain active ingredients like retinol, peptides, and antioxidants that target specific skin concerns such as fine lines, dryness, and uneven texture. By applying a night cream before bed, you give your skin the opportunity to absorb these beneficial ingredients, resulting in a more radiant complexion by morning.

Some key benefits of using night cream include:
  • Intensive hydration: Provides deep moisture to combat dryness.
  • Skin repair: Supports the skin's natural repair processes that occur overnight.
  • Anti-aging properties: Helps re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.
  • Improved texture: Promotes smoother and softer skin.

When choosing the right night cream, consider your skin type and specific concerns. For example, those with oily skin may prefer a lightweight, gel-based formula, while dry skin types might benefit from a richer, creamier texture. Remember, the right night cream can significantly enhance your nighttime skincare routine, leading to healthier and more vibrant skin.
